How B2B Shades Unlocked 30% in Production Capacity (and headed to SaaS)


  • Client: B2B roller shade manufacturer in NJ, USA.
  • Change: Migration from spreadsheets to a system for order intake & validation.
  • Impact: +30% in order shipment; 50% less owner involvement.
THE CLIENT

B2B Shades is a roller shade manufacturer based in NJ, supplying wholesale offices and schools across the U.S.

ADMIN HASSLE

As order volume grew, working in spreadsheets became fragile: too many files, files grew larger and started to corrupt, manual entry errors increased, and key processes depended heavily on the owner’s know-how.

AUTOMATING NATIVELY

Cyber Pioneers Inc. eliminated order processing bottlenecks by migrating the client from Excel to a system designed to streamline order intake and order validation workflows, mimicking a familiar spreadsheet interface.

GROWTH IS IN ORDER

In the first version, it increased order shipment capacity by 30% and reduced the owner’s day-to-day operational involvement by 50%.

“Even the first rough version productivity increased by 30%. What used to be our best month in 2023 is now just an average month.” - Paul, the CEO.
THE PROBLEM
  • Larger spreadsheets began to corrupt.
  • Complex business rules were difficult to manage in spreadsheets.
  • Order entry was slow, single-user, and prone to errors.
“..files nobody had even touched, yet the numbers inside changed on their own. I felt like this was the end” - Paul, the CEO.

Why off-the-shelf ERPs didn’t fit

  • PIP required complicated customisation, long integration, and was expensive.
  • BlindMatrix did not fit the existing manufacturing workflow and would resist adapting the product.
  • Both take years to integrate and implement custom features.

“I need freedom and customization. I don’t want to be locked into their logic, their limits, and their vision…you depend on them, …we started building our own solution, so all mission-critical stuff is in-house…and I know I can make it better.” - Paul, the CEO.

LEARNING ON-SITE

Given the criticality of the prospective software to manufacturing, Vitalii would commute to the production facility to better grasp the business and learn how the owner envisions interacting with the system.

Metrics set to improve:

  • Minimise order entry time and make it multi-user.
  • Prevent erroneous orders from entering production.
MAKING A THINK TANK

Vitalii would brainstorm the user interfaces on-site with the owner and operators, so

  • employees onboarded naturally, and
  • employees’ productivity improvement was assured.
THE SOLUTION

A software system was developed to streamline Order Intake and Validation workflows for window-shade fabrication. The order registry was moved from spreadsheets to a database governed by production business rules. The user interface was designed to mimic spreadsheets, ensuring operators work in the way they’re used to.

Workflows supported:
  • Prompted order composing and order validation flow
  • Order quote generation
  • Business rule entry and rule editing user flow
BUSINESS IMPACT

The first production-ready version of the system delivered an 8× ROI in the first year by preventing faulty orders from entering production.

  • +30% increase in order shipment capacity
  • 50% reduction in the owner’s operational involvement
  • 8x ROI in the first year, payback period - 2 months
  • better employee satisfaction (less rework)

“No, I’m not home earlier, but I’m now less of a hands-on operator and more of an owner who runs things.” - Paul, the CEO.

CLIENT FEEDBACK

“Every goal we set has been nailed. Now we’re onto the next level: inventory, dashboards, analytics, reports.” - Paul, the CEO.

After three years of adding workflows and features, the client decided to productize the system as a SaaS offering for other roller-shade fabricators.

Ultimately, I see it as a vertically integrated solution for fabricators.” - Paul, the CEO.
